Banana muffins(scotgirl recipe from MN adapted from just egg free)
Makes 6
Preheat oven 190oc,gas 5(170oc fan)
2tbsp vegan butter, melted
2tbsp nut milk
2 bananas,mashed
1tsp vanilla
Mix tog

1cup+2tbsp(150g)self raising flour
1tsp baking powder
Fold in til just mix(add handful choc chip,dry fruit,chop nuts or seeds at that point too if wished)
Bake 20mins til golden brown

Stilllivinginazoo · 19/02/2017 17:11

Forgot add I've learnt very important cool banana vegan muffins on rack NOT in muffin tin or they absorb steam and go soggy!!
The mix may seem but squidgy,but it firms as cools

EEK.FORGOT SUGAR-ADD 2tbsp WITH FLOUR any type(or you can add liquid sugar with butter and melt together)

The pancake recipe I used was on allrecipes.co.uk but I adapted it as it works better like this
150g plain flour
2 tea spoons of bakin powder
2 heaped table spoons sugar
Pinch of salt
2 table spoons of oil
300ml (soya/nut milk)
Whisk all together and fry (in dairy free spread is best for taste not oil).
